
Jennofer
Jennofer is a unique variant of the more commonly known name Jennifer, which is of Cornish origin meaning 'white shadow' or 'white wave.' Though primarily feminine, its unusual spelling gives it a modern and distinctive flair. The name gained popularity in the mid-20th century, inspired by figures in popular culture, particularly the enchanting character Jennifer from literature and film.
People perceive Jennofer as an attractive and contemporary name, with a hint of originality. While the name is straightforward in its sound, its uncommon spelling may lead to occasional pronunciation challenges.
In popular culture, the name Jennifer has been used in numerous films and literature, often associated with strength and beauty, increasing the appeal of its variant, Jennofer. This name melds tradition with a fresh twist, appealing to parents exploring creative naming options.
